Meta Platforms has launched the latest versions of its large language model, Llama, introducing Llama 4 Scout and Llama 4 Maverick as its most advanced artificial intelligence systems to date.

The company described the new models as multimodal, capable of processing and integrating text, video, images and audio, and converting content across these formats.


Meta said both Llama 4 Scout and Llama 4 Maverick will be released as open source software.


The company also previewed Llama 4 Behemoth, which it called one of the smartest large language models in the world and its most powerful yet. Meta said Behemoth will serve as a teacher for future models.


The release comes amid intense competition in the AI sector, with major technology firms investing heavily in infrastructure following the rise of OpenAI’s ChatGPT.


Meta plans to spend up to USD 65 billion this year to expand its AI infrastructure, as investors push for returns on AI investments.


According to a report by The Information, Meta delayed the launch of Llama 4 after the model failed to meet internal benchmarks, particularly in reasoning and mathematics.


The report also noted concerns that Llama 4 was less capable than OpenAI’s models in conducting humanlike voice conversations.
